Giant butter bean stew

This authentic vegetarian casserole makes a delicious first course, or serve alongside slow-cooked lamb as part of a Greek Easter feast

Ingredients

6 serv.
  • butter beans4 x 235g cans cans

    or 500g dried butter beans (cook according to pack instructions)

  • Greek extra virgin olive oil100ml ml
  • small red onions3

    finely sliced

  • large carrots2

    finely sliced

  • celery3

    stalks with leaves, finely chopped

  • sundried tomatoes4

    sliced

  • ripe tomatoes1kg kg

    skinned, deseeded and finely chopped

  • garlic cloves4

    chopped

  • paprika1 tsp tsp
  • ground cinnamon1 tsp tsp
  • tomato purée2 tbsp tbsp
  • sugar1 tsp tsp
  • flat-leaf parsleysmall pack

    finely chopped

  • dillsmall pack

    finely chopped

  • feta100g g

    (optional), crumbled

Step-by-step instructions

  1. 1

    Drain the canned beans, reserving 200ml of the liquid. Heat the oil in a large flameproof lidded casserole dish, and cook the onions, carrots and celery until tender and the onions are soft and transparent, but not coloured. Stir in the remaining ingredients, reserving half of the chopped herbs and feta (if using).

  2. 2

    He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4. Cook over a gentle heat for a further 5 mins, then pour over the reserved liquid. Cover the dish and bake in the oven for 40 mins. Check occasionally that the beans are not drying out – add a little more water if needed.

  3. 3

    Remove the lid and bake for 10 mins more. Can be made 2 days ahead and reheated. Stir through the reserved chopped herbs, season to taste, then crumble over the remaining feta just before serving.
